A list of the most recent deficiencies for Northern Lights Hcc. The list is based on the information provided by CMS from both standard inspections and from complaints filed by residents.

Deficiency Type of Deficiency Deficiency Date Date Corrected Resulted from a Complaint?
Let residents refuse treatment, refuse to take part in an experiment, or formulate advance directives. Health 2017-05-03 2017-06-02 N
1) Hire only people with no legal history of abusing, neglecting or mistreating residents; or 2) report and investigate any acts or reports of abuse, neglect or mistreatment of residents. Health 2017-05-03 2017-06-02 N
Store, cook, and serve food in a safe and clean way. Health 2017-05-03 2017-06-02 N
Conduct initial and periodic assessments of each resident's functional capacity.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-23 N
Develop a complete care plan that meets all the resident's needs, with timetables and actions that can be measured.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-23 N
Ensure that each resident who enters the nursing home without a catheter is not given a catheter, unless medically necessary, and that incontinent patients receive proper services to prevent urinary tract infections and restore normal bladder functions.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-23 N
Ensure that residents with limited range of motion receive appropriate treatment and services to increase range of motion or prevent further decrease in range of motion.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-23 N
Ensure that each resident's 1) entire drug/medication regimen is free from unnecessary drugs; and 2) is managed and monitored to achieve highest level of well-being.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-23 N
At least once a month, have a licensed pharmacist review each resident's medication(s) and report any irregularities to the attending doctor.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-19 N
Review or revise the resident's care plan after any major change in physical or mental health.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-14 N
Ensure each resident receives an accurate assessment by a qualified health professional.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-14 N
Store, cook, and serve food in a safe and clean way.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-14 N
Assure that each resident?s assessment is updated at least once every 3 months. Health 2015-04-23 2015-05-13 N
Post nurse staffing information/data on a daily basis. Health 2015-04-23 2015-04-23 N
